Is Loxe or Openkey.co Easier to Use?

Loxe scores a perfect 5/5 for ease of use in recent reviews, with users praising its intuitive interface and straightforward installation. Customers also highlight smooth onboarding processes and quick staff adoption, citing minimal training requirements.

OpenKey also boasts a high ease-of-use rating at 4.45/5, with many users appreciating the user-friendly app and seamless integration with PMS systems like WebRezPro and StayNTouch. However, some reviews mention occasional technical glitches and app crashes, which could slow staff adaptation.

Edge: Loxe. Its review profile indicates consistently high satisfaction with usability and onboarding, making it a better choice if ease of implementation is a top priority.

Which Has Better Features: Loxe or Openkey.co?

Loxe offers 9 shared features with OpenKey, including mobile keys, guest messaging, and PMS integration, but it also has one unique feature: Access Management Solution (Server Based). This allows more control over access rights and enhanced security options.

OpenKey, however, provides 7 features that Loxe lacks, such as notifications, multi-property management, mobile check-in, developer SDK, and door lock upgrade kits. Its broad feature set supports complex hotel operations and larger property portfolios.

While OpenKey’s wider feature count and integrations appeal to larger chains, Loxe’s simplicity and upselling features cater well to smaller or mid-sized hotels seeking added revenue streams.

Edge: OpenKey. Its broader feature set and multi-property management capabilities make it more versatile for diverse hotel needs.

Which Has Better Customer Support: Loxe or Openkey.co?

Loxe’s reviews consistently praise its customer support, scoring 5/5 in recent feedback, with clients emphasizing quick responses and attentive service. Reviewers mention that Loxe’s support team is highly responsive and helpful during onboarding and ongoing use.

OpenKey also scores well at 4.25/5, with users appreciating the support experience, though some note delays and occasional communication gaps. Many reviews highlight the support team’s responsiveness, but Loxe’s entire review profile leans toward higher satisfaction.

Edge: Loxe. The consistently high support ratings and positive review comments suggest it offers a more reliable support experience.

How Much Do Loxe and Openkey.co Cost?

Loxe does not publish specific pricing details, which suggests a customized quote approach, common for platforms with upselling or broad feature sets. It markets itself as an affordable mobile key solution, emphasizing value for money.

OpenKey charges a base fee of $500, with no listed ongoing monthly costs, and requires no implementation fee. Its pricing structure appears straightforward, suitable for hotels seeking predictable costs.

If budget transparency is critical, OpenKey’s flat fee offers clarity, but Loxe’s custom pricing could be more economical for smaller properties.

How Does HTR Evaluate and Rank Loxe and Openkey.co?

The HT Score is a composite ranking that considers 4 criteria groups and over a dozen variables to help hoteliers objectively compare hotel technology products. Loxe has an HT Score of 0 and OpenKey has 39. Here is how the score is calculated.

Criteria Group Weight What It Measures
Customer Ratings & Reviews

How highly do users recommend this product?

Ratings Score, Review Volume, Share of Voice, Review Depth, Review Recency, Success Stories

The most heavily weighted factor. Analyzes average satisfaction ratings (likelihood to recommend, ease of use, support, ROI), total review count relative to category peers, review recency (at least 20 reviews in the trailing 6 months), and share of voice across unique hotel clients to detect selection bias.

Partner Ecosystem

How highly do tech partners recommend this company?

Partner Recommendations, Integration Quantity, Integration Quality

Evaluates partner recommendations as expert votes of confidence, the number of verified integrations, and ecosystem quality — the average HT Scores of integration partners. Products with higher-quality integration ecosystems are more likely to deliver a connected tech stack.

Customer Centricity

How customer-centric is this organization?

Certified Support, Review Consistency, Profile Completeness

Assesses whether the company has earned HTR Customer Support Certification, maintains consistent review collection over time (an indicator of feedback-driven culture), and keeps product profiles complete with capabilities, screenshots, pricing, and features.

Reach, Staying Power & Resources

How extensive is this company's reach and resourcing?

Geographic Reach, Staying Power, Company Resources, Trending Score

Measures global presence (countries and regions served), years in business as a stability proxy, team headcount as a resource proxy, and a trending score based on trailing-twelve-month buyer inquiries, reviews, partner recommendations, and press activity.

Customer ratings and reviews are by far the most important factor in the HT Score algorithm. HTR does not accept payment for higher rankings. All reviews are verified — only hotel industry practitioners with confirmed affiliations can submit ratings. View full HT Score methodology →
